Can I edit a scanned PDF using this tool?

Scanned PDFs are image-based files, meaning the text inside them is part of a picture rather than selectable characters. This editor works best with text-based PDFs where the content was generated digitally. For scanned documents, you can still annotate over them, add text boxes on top, insert shapes, and place signatures, but you cannot edit the original scanned text itself the way you would in a word processor.

Will the formatting of my PDF change after editing?

The existing layout, fonts, and structure of your PDF remain intact. The editor overlays your additions on top of the original content rather than reprocessing the entire document structure. This means your original formatting stays as it was, and only the elements you deliberately add or modify will appear different in the output file.

Can I use this tool to fill in PDF forms?

Yes. If your PDF contains interactive form fields such as text input boxes, checkboxes, or dropdown menus, you can click into those fields and fill them in directly through the editor. For non-interactive forms where fields are printed as static lines, you can use the text insertion tool to type your responses into the appropriate areas manually.
